Output 4dc62d169a0ad107e94c107f707e24fac7da4fe3e492277b8a9e23a3e58b2e34:0

value
10500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2cae6554c2353ca3dae2ad1c7b3c763a2f95811 OP_EQUAL
address
3PpnWgqnetp7S3PDjcDxb4QuMQszGX29sA
transaction
4dc62d169a0ad107e94c107f707e24fac7da4fe3e492277b8a9e23a3e58b2e34
spent
true